Speed & Performance Considerations
VPN performance may vary depending on network conditions, ISP routing, VPN server load, protocol selection, operating system configuration, torrent health, geographic region, and internet connection quality.
TinyTorrent may evaluate factors such as:
- Connection consistency
- Download stability
- General torrenting performance
- Server responsiveness
- P2P server availability
- Performance impact during torrent downloads
Privacy & Security Features
TinyTorrent may also review privacy-related VPN features commonly relevant to torrent users, including:
- Kill switch support
- DNS leak protection
- Split tunneling availability
- Encryption protocols
- Multi-device support
- P2P server policies
VPN features, policies, and availability may change over time depending on provider updates and software versions.
